Pence, Ivanka visit salon damaged by Minneapolis unrest

by Associated Press
| September 25, 2020 12:09 AM

MINNEAPOLIS (AP) — Vice President Mike Pence and Ivanka Trump made an unannounced stop Thursday at a hair salon left in rubble by the violence that followed George Floyd's death, part of a campaign visit aimed at driving home President Donald Trump's law-and-order message in a key swing state.
